The survey conducted by iData shows that 58% of respondents would support Moldova's accession to the EU through a referendum, while 31% would vote against. The poll also revealed that 40.5% would be in favor of the country leaving the Commonwealth of Independent States (CIS) and 35.5% against. Maia Sandu is still the favorite for another term as president, according to the same poll.
